13*456920b3SKrzysztof KozlowskiPatch Review and Handling
14*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ski-------------------------
15*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ski
16*456920b3SKrzysztof KozlowskiPatches handled by Devicetree maintainers are processed differently depending
17*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owskion the patch type:
18*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ski
19*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ski1. Core OF driver code, e.g. drivers/of/:
20*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ski   patches are reviewed and applied by DT maintainers.
21*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ski
22*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ski2. Devicetree bindings:
23*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ski   patches are reviewed by DT maintainers, but should be applied by subsystem
24*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ski   maintainers except in certain cases.  See also *For kernel maintainers* in
25*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ski   Documentation/devicetree/bindings/submitting-patches.rst.
26*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ski
27*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ski3. DTS and drivers:
28*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ski   DT maintainers might provide comments, but review is generally not expected.
29*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ski   DTS must pass schema checks (dtbs_check) or at least do not add any
30*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ski   new warnings.

32*456920b3SKrzysztof KozlowskiPatchwork
33*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ski~~~~~~~~~
34*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ski
35*456920b3SKrzysztof KozlowskiDevicetree maintainers review patches using Patchwork, so the current status of
36*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owskia patch can be checked there. For typical driver submissions, Patchwork
37*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owskireceives the entire patch set, but only a few patches are usually Devicetree
38*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owskibindings that are reviewed by DT maintainers.
39*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ski
40*456920b3SKrzysztof KozlowskiExplanation of Patchwork statuses:
41*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ski
42*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ski - **New**: Not yet processed by the automation toolset.
43*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ski - **Needs ACK**: Waiting for review by DT maintainers.
44*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ski - **Handled Elsewhere**: Non-DT patch; not being reviewed here.
45*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ski - **RFC**: Patch was likely ignored because it was an incomplete RFC.
46*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ski - **Changes Requested**: Patch was reviewed and DT maintainers expect changes.
47*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ski - **Accepted**: Patch was reviewed and applied by DT maintainers to their tree.
48*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ski - **Not Applicable**: Patch was reviewed and is likely in good shape, with a
49*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ski   *Reviewed-by* or *Acked-by* tag provided, but DT maintainers expect someone
50*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ski   else to apply it.

52*456920b3SKrzysztof KozlowskiPatch Re-review and Pinging
53*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
54*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ski
55*456920b3SKrzysztof KozlowskiDue to the high volume of email traffic, Devicetree maintainers do not read
56*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owskievery email they receive and instead rely on Patchwork during the review
57*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owskiprocess. They also often skip patches that have already been reviewed.
58*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ski
59*456920b3SKrzysztof KozlowskiAs a result, maintainers might miss:
60*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ski
61*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ski1. Questions about already reviewed patches.
62*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ski2. Pings, for example when a patch has been reviewed by DT maintainers but has
63*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ski   not been picked up by subsystem maintainers.
64*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ski
65*456920b3SKrzysztof KozlowskiSuch cases can be addressed by:
66*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ski
67*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ski1. Pinging DT maintainers on the IRC channel.
68*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ski2. Dropping the DT maintainer’s *Acked-by* or *Reviewed-by* tag when sending a new
69*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ski   version of the patch set, together with an explanation in the patch
70*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ski   changelog describing why the tag was removed and what is expected from DT
71*456920b3SKrzysztof Kozlowski   maintainers.
